Video Of The Day: Dhoni Steps Out For Toss After 683 Days

The last time Dhoni stepped out for the toss in the IPL was back in 2023, when he ended up winning the title for Chennai Super Kings. After this hugely rewarding season, Dhoni stepped down as the captain of the side, and this was when Chennai announced Ruturaj Gaikwad is the new captain. 

However, with Gaikwad, getting injured and getting ruled out for the remainder of this season, Dhoni has returned as the captain of Chennai. 

Incidentally, he stepped out for the toss today, and he was received with a monster crowd eruption at the Chennai Stadium. The whole stadium absolutely erupted in joy, and cheers while Dhoni stepped out. 

Incidentally, Dhoni has come out for the toss as the captain of Chennai after a break of 683 days, and this makes the occasion all the more special for Chennai fans. The video of Dhoni at the toss is not going viral on social media.
